Applying formal methods to an embedded real-time avionics system
The authors present an application of formal development methodology to an actual real-time embedded system. The formal methods used are based on Modechart a graphical state specification language for real-time systems, whose formal semantic definition provides the basis for analysis. The specifications may be automatically simulated, or verified with respect to user-provided safety, liveness, and timing assertions. The application is of non-toy size and functionality, and features many state-of-the-practice design properties, such as parallel priority-based synchronizing processes with preemption.<>
